The best way to grade this feud story is to separate the revisited romance part from the modern drama part of this IMO. In regards to revisiting the romance between Santo and Colleen today, I thought the show gets an A+. Ali and James did a good job with the accents. James was shaky in the beginning but grew more comfortable as time went on. This is one instance where Wyman's SFX helped. The murky look to the scenes was a nice touch. It was like a classic romance and I thought it showed a good deal of effort and I applaud them for this. We all knew this was where they were going based on how the story had occurred so it should be no surprise it dragged a little since today was the accounts of the first meeting of the two lovers. I also thought James and Ali were great in portraying the awkwardness between the two. Good acting there and the extra were solid too. This won't be the whole summer. The whole summer is about how what happened affects those we love and where it will all lead. I do think this story is going to be dividing fans though. It's already started and it has people talking so Days probably succeeded in that regard, at least.

I loved the commentaries from Lucas. BD and AS were great today. Hilarious scenes and good to see them having fun/ Loved having D&J, J&M, and B&H involved. A little too short but better then nothing.

Nick is so miserable that it makes me long for Chelsea/Jett real bad. I did like the end with him telling her about Kate. Glad that wasn't dragged out. I think the writing for Nick is not as good as before but alot of it is on Blake too. He isn't putting alot of energy into Nick right now IMO and I feel that is making this worse.

The rest of the airline crew was ok. Loved the Jett/Danielle reveal. My theory is that they are cops after Jeremy. Jett being a cop would follow the Carver tradition quite well. I do like Jett and Danielle alot. I like how we got more insight into Jeremy and Stephanie and their relationship. I always like when they show how Steph longs for love. That is at the heart of this and is the reason why she changed IMO. She was unlucky in love before she left Salem and, in order to have a chance with Jeremy, she changed to fit his standards and once and awhile we see a few cracks in her facade. She was always a romantic and wanting her parents together and so on so having her want more with Jeremy then what she is getting and her reaction to his words and behavior today fell in line quite well IMO.

Good show to start the week.
